html随机验证码

   2026-03-21 00
核心提示:HTML随机验证码是一种基于HTML和JavaScript技术生成的用于验证用户身份的安全措施。它通过生成随机数字和字母组合,要求用户输入正确的验证码以完成注册或登录等操作。这种验证码可以有效防止机器人或恶意软件自动提交表单,提高网站的安全性。

在HTML中生成随机验证码通常涉及到JavaScript的使用,因为HTML本身并不包含生成随机数的功能。以下是一个简单的例子,使用JavaScript生成一个随机的验证码并显示在一个HTML页面上。请注意,这只是一个基本的示例,实际的验证码系统可能需要更复杂的安全措施。

html随机验证码

创建一个HTML页面,包含一个用于显示验证码的元素:

<!DOCTYPE html>
<html>
<head>
    <title>随机验证码生成器</title>
</head>
<body>
    <h1>随机验证码</h1>
    <p id="verificationCode"></p>
    <button onclick="generateVerificationCode()">生成验证码</button>
    <script src="https://www.271shop.com/static/image/lazy.gif" class="lazy" original="https://www.271shop.com/static/image/nopic320.png">

创建一个名为verificationCode.js 的JavaScript文件,用于生成随机验证码:

function generateVerificationCode() {
    var codeLength = 6; // 设置验证码长度
    var chars = ’ABCDEFGHIJKLMNOPQRSTUVWXYZabcdefghijklmnopqrstuvwxyz0123456789’; // 可选的字符集
    var result = ’’;
    for (var i = 0; i < codeLength; i++) {
        var index = Math.floor(Math.random() * chars.length); // 生成随机索引
        result += chars[index]; // 添加字符到结果字符串中
    }
    document.getElementById(’verificationCode’).innerText = result; // 显示验证码
}

在这个例子中,当用户点击按钮时,会触发generateVerificationCode 函数,该函数会生成一个由大写字母、小写字母和数字组成的随机验证码,并将其显示在网页上,你可以根据需要调整codeLengthchars 变量来改变生成的验证码的长度和字符集,这只是一个简单的示例,并不适用于需要高度安全性的场景,在实际应用中,你可能需要使用更复杂的算法和服务器端的验证来确保安全性。

 
举报评论 0
 
更多>同类资讯
推荐图文
推荐资讯
点击排行
友情链接
网站首页  |  关于我们  |  联系方式  |  用户协议  |  隐私政策  |  版权声明  |  网站地图  |  排名推广  |  广告服务  |  积分换礼  |  网站留言  |  RSS订阅  |  违规举报